zephyr/scripts/west_commands/runners
Carles Cufi 6659d2d711 scripts: runners: nrfutil: Check return code after Popen
The code invoking nrfutil was not checking the return code of the
subprocess, which meant that if the underlying tool was exiting with a
failure error code it remained undetected.

Signed-off-by: Carles Cufi <carles.cufi@nordicsemi.no>
2025-05-13 17:45:09 +02:00
..
__init__.py west: runners: add flash runner for sensry sy1xx socs 2025-04-04 12:06:07 +02:00
blackmagicprobe.py scripts: west_commands: runners: Fix f-string (UP032) 2024-11-22 17:40:37 +01:00
bossac.py west: runners: bossac: Honor --erase flag 2024-12-22 18:20:30 +00:00
canopen_program.py scripts: west_commands: runners: Fix line-too-long (E501) 2024-11-22 17:40:37 +01:00
core.py scripts: west_commands: runners: do not print newline in telnet decode 2025-05-08 12:25:07 +02:00
dediprog.py scripts: west_commands: runners: Sort and format imports (I001) 2024-11-22 17:40:37 +01:00
dfu.py scripts: west_commands: runners: Fix f-string (UP032) 2024-11-22 17:40:37 +01:00
ecpprog.py west: runner: add support for ecpprog 2024-12-19 08:38:55 +01:00
esp32.py scripts: west_commands: runners: esp32: add flash encryption option 2025-01-13 10:09:36 +01:00
ezflashcli.py scripts: west_commands: runners: Fix line-too-long (E501) 2024-11-22 17:40:37 +01:00
gd32isp.py scripts: west_commands: runners: Sort and format imports (I001) 2024-11-22 17:40:37 +01:00
hifive1.py scripts: west_commands: runners: Sort and format imports (I001) 2024-11-22 17:40:37 +01:00
intel_adsp.py scripts and soc: Mark MD5 and SHA1 usage as not for security 2025-03-11 04:52:15 +01:00
intel_cyclonev.py scripts: west_commands: runners: Fix line-too-long (E501) 2024-11-22 17:40:37 +01:00
jlink.py scripts: west: flash: Add support for .mot file format 2025-05-02 09:18:16 +02:00
linkserver.py scripts: west_commands: runners: Fix line-too-long (E501) 2024-11-22 17:40:37 +01:00
mdb.py scripts: west_commands: runners: Fix line-too-long (E501) 2024-11-22 17:40:37 +01:00
minichlink.py runners: add minichlink 2024-11-26 14:41:46 +00:00
misc.py scripts: west_commands: runners: Sort and format imports (I001) 2024-11-22 17:40:37 +01:00
native.py scripts: west_commands: runners: Fix f-string (UP032) 2024-11-22 17:40:37 +01:00
nios2.py scripts: west_commands: runners: Fix f-string (UP032) 2024-11-22 17:40:37 +01:00
nrf_common.py west: runners: nrf_common: Temp hack for NRF54H20_IRON 2025-04-24 20:28:51 +02:00
nrfjprog.py west: runners: nrf: Add an option to control the ext erase mode 2025-04-16 08:07:44 +02:00
nrfutil.py scripts: runners: nrfutil: Check return code after Popen 2025-05-13 17:45:09 +02:00
nsim.py scripts: west_commands: runners: Fix f-string (UP032) 2024-11-22 17:40:37 +01:00
nxp_s32dbg.py scripts: west_commands: runners: Sort and format imports (I001) 2024-11-22 17:40:37 +01:00
openocd.py west: runners: openocd: Add option to start RTT server during debug 2025-04-29 20:08:20 -04:00
probe_rs.py scripts: west_commands: runners: Sort and format imports (I001) 2024-11-22 17:40:37 +01:00
pyocd.py scripts: west_commands: runners: Fix line-too-long (E501) 2024-11-22 17:40:37 +01:00
qemu.py scripts: west_commands: runners: Sort and format imports (I001) 2024-11-22 17:40:37 +01:00
renode-robot.py scripts: west_commands: runners: Fix line-too-long (E501) 2024-11-22 17:40:37 +01:00
renode.py scripts: west_commands: runners: Fix line-too-long (E501) 2024-11-22 17:40:37 +01:00
rfp.py west: runners: rfp: Add Reneses Flash Programmer runner 2025-03-31 19:49:22 -04:00
silabs_commander.py scripts: west_commands: runners: Fix line-too-long (E501) 2024-11-22 17:40:37 +01:00
spi_burn.py scripts: west_commands: runners: Fix line-too-long (E501) 2024-11-22 17:40:37 +01:00
stm32cubeprogrammer.py scripts: west: runners: stm32cubeprogrammer: Fix stm32n6 dfu flashing 2025-03-06 17:18:25 +00:00
stm32flash.py scripts: west_commands: runners: Fix f-string (UP032) 2024-11-22 17:40:37 +01:00
sy1xx.py west: runners: add flash runner for sensry sy1xx socs 2025-04-04 12:06:07 +02:00
teensy.py scripts: west_commands: runners: teensy: Replace printf with f-string 2024-12-03 23:30:00 +00:00
trace32.py scripts: west_commands: runners: Fix unused/deprecated imports (F401/UP035) 2024-11-22 17:40:37 +01:00
uf2.py scripts: west_commands: runners: Sort and format imports (I001) 2024-11-22 17:40:37 +01:00
xsdb.py west_commands: runners: Fix parameters passed to xsdb 2025-02-14 08:44:54 +01:00
xtensa.py scripts: west_commands: runners: Sort and format imports (I001) 2024-11-22 17:40:37 +01:00